Watch Student Debut Presentations Now!

Watch Student Debut Presentations Now!

How will marijuana legalization impact New York? How does poverty impact mental health? What do youth think about these issues? Watch two student debut presentations and their documentaries now to find out!

1. Puff Puff Passed

CUP collaborated with Teaching Artist Elliott Golden and students from the Red Hook Community Justice Center to investigate how marijuana legalization will impact New York.

Watch their documentary and check out their debut presentation below!

2. Bronx Be Well

CUP and Teaching Artist Hugo Rojas collaborated with students from Fannie Lou Hamer Freedom High School in the Bronx to investigate how poverty impacts mental health.

Watch their film and check out their presentation below!
